Comprehensive Review of Project Management Tools: Which One is Right for You?

Managing projects efficiently can be the difference between meeting deadlines and missing them. Whether you’re a freelancer, part of a team, or managing multiple departments, selecting the right project management tool is essential. To help you decide, we’ve reviewed the most popular project management tools based on their features, usability, pricing, and suitability.


1. Trello

Best For: Visual Learners and Small Teams

Trello uses a card-and-board system based on the Kanban methodology. Its simplicity and visual appeal make it perfect for organizing workflows and tasks.

Features:

  • Drag-and-drop interface
  • Integration with apps like Slack and Google Drive
  • Customizable boards

Pros:

  • Intuitive and easy to use
  • Free version supports basic needs

Cons:

  • Limited features for larger teams

Pricing: Free, Paid plans start at $5/user/month


2. Asana

Best For: Task Management and Team Collaboration

Asana excels at task tracking and project organization. Its features cater to teams that value detail-oriented planning and collaboration.

Features:

  • Task dependencies and project timelines
  • Automation of recurring tasks
  • Seamless integration with apps

Pros:

  • Highly customizable
  • Clean and user-friendly interface

Cons:

  • Steeper learning curve for new users

Pricing: Free, Premium plans start at $10.99/user/month


3. Monday.com

Best For: Medium to Large Teams

Monday.com offers a visually appealing workspace with flexible templates. It’s particularly effective for teams managing complex projects.

Features:

  • Robust reporting and analytics
  • Built-in time tracking
  • Custom automation workflows

Pros:

  • Highly versatile for different industries
  • Excellent customer support

Cons:

  • Can feel overwhelming initially

Pricing: Starts at $8/seat/month (3-user minimum)


4. ClickUp

Best For: All-in-One Solution Seekers

ClickUp combines multiple tools into a single platform, making it a powerhouse for teams that need task management, time tracking, and documentation.

Features:

  • Highly customizable views (list, board, Gantt)
  • Goal tracking and task priority levels
  • Unlimited integrations

Pros:

  • All-in-one workspace
  • Generous free version

Cons:

  • Can be overly feature-packed for simple projects

Pricing: Free, Premium plans start at $5/user/month


5. Microsoft Project

Best For: Enterprise-Level Project Management

Microsoft Project is ideal for enterprises that need advanced project management solutions. It seamlessly integrates with Microsoft Office tools.

Features:

  • Advanced Gantt charts and reporting
  • Resource allocation tracking
  • Workflow automation

Pros:

  • Highly detailed and feature-rich
  • Best for large-scale projects

Cons:

  • Expensive for small teams
  • Steep learning curve

Pricing: Starts at $10/user/month


6. Basecamp

Best For: Simple and Straightforward Projects

Basecamp is a no-frills tool designed for small to medium-sized teams that prioritize simplicity and straightforward collaboration.

Features:

  • To-do lists and message boards
  • Built-in scheduling and file sharing
  • Hill charts for progress tracking

Pros:

  • Flat pricing for unlimited users
  • Easy to set up and use

Cons:

  • Lacks advanced features like task dependencies

Pricing: $15/user/month or $299/year (flat rate for all users)


7. Smartsheet

Best For: Spreadsheet Enthusiasts

Smartsheet marries the flexibility of spreadsheets with powerful project management features, catering to teams accustomed to Excel-like tools.

Features:

  • Gantt chart views
  • Resource and budget tracking
  • Automation capabilities

Pros:

  • Highly customizable
  • Easy transition for Excel users

Cons:

  • Pricing can be steep for small teams

Pricing: Starts at $7/user/month


8. Jira

Best For: Software Development Teams

Jira is tailored for Agile and Scrum teams, making it a top choice for developers. It streamlines sprint planning, bug tracking, and feature management.

Features:

  • Scrum and Kanban boards
  • Sprint and backlog management
  • Integration with development tools

Pros:

  • Designed for Agile methodologies
  • Extensive integrations

Cons:

  • Not ideal for non-technical teams

Pricing: Free, Premium plans start at $7.75/user/month


9. Zoho Projects

Best For: Budget-Conscious Teams

Zoho Projects offers a robust project management solution at an affordable price, catering to teams that need cost-effective tools.

Features:

  • Gantt charts and task tracking
  • Time tracking and reporting
  • Team collaboration tools

Pros:

  • Budget-friendly pricing
  • Easy integration with Zoho Suite

Cons:

  • Limited advanced features

Pricing: Free, Premium plans start at $5/user/month


10. Wrike

Best For: Collaboration-Focused Teams

Wrike is built for teams that value collaboration and advanced task management features. It caters to both small teams and large organizations.

Features:

  • Custom dashboards and task prioritization
  • Real-time collaboration tools
  • Advanced analytics and reporting

Pros:

  • Intuitive and feature-rich
  • Strong collaboration features

Cons:

  • Add-ons can increase costs

Pricing: Free, Paid plans start at $9.80/user/month


Which One Is Right for You?

The best project management tool for you depends on your team size, project complexity, and budget:

  • For simple workflows: Trello or Basecamp
  • For detail-oriented planning: Asana or ClickUp
  • For development teams: Jira
  • For large-scale enterprise projects: Microsoft Project or Monday.com

Each tool brings unique strengths, so weigh your priorities carefully.
